Eligibility
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: American Society Of Anaesthesiologist grade I and II Patients willing to give informed consent
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: Pregnant women patients with history of long term use of corticosteroids or any analgesics patients with history of allergy to study drugs
Design outcomes
Primary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| To compare the duration of postoperative analgesia between epidural morphine versus combination of epidural morphine with dexamethasone among patients undergoing infraumbilical surgeriesTimepoint: 24 hours | — |
Secondary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| to compare adverse effects and hemodynamic changes between two groupsTimepoint: 24 hours | — |
